  • Patent number: 4429095
    Abstract: The invention provides new compounds which are cyclic alkylene ureas produced by the reaction of an alkylene urea selected from the group consisting of a mono-(alkylene ureido alkyl) urea, a bis-(alkylene ureido alkyl) urea, and mixtures thereof, with an unsaturated glycidyl ether or ester, such as allyl glycidyl ether. The new compounds are monomers which may be incorporated in aqueous emulsion polymer systems and are useful as wet adhesion promoters for latex paints.

  • Patent number: 4426503
    Abstract: The invention provides new compounds which are cyclic alkylene ureas having hydroxyl and amine functionalities and which are produced by the reaction of an omega-amino alkyl alkylene urea, such as 2-aminoethyl ethylene urea, with an unsaturated glycidyl ether or ester, such as allyl glycidyl ether. The new compounds are monomers which may be incorporated in aqueous emulsion polymer systems and are useful as wet adhesion promoters for latex paints.
